--- /home/cvs/shishi/gl/gettime.c 2004/07/02 09:19:39 1.2
+++ /home/cvs/shishi/gl/gettime.c 2005/03/14 14:32:14 1.3
@@ -1,5 +1,5 @@
/* gettime -- get the system clock
- Copyright (C) 2002, 2004 Free Software Foundation, Inc.
+ Copyright (C) 2002, 2004, 2005 Free Software Foundation, Inc.
This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ify
it under the terms of the GNU General Public License as published by
@@ -23,37 +23,31 @@
#include "timespec.h"
-/* Get the system time. */
+/* Get the system time into *TS. */
-int
+void
gettime (struct timespec *ts)
{
-#if defined CLOCK_REALTIME && HAVE_CLOCK_GETTIME
+#if HAVE_NANOTIME
+ nanotime (ts);
+#else
+
+# if defined CLOCK_REALTIME && HAVE_CLOCK_GETTIME
if (clock_gettime (CLOCK_REALTIME, ts) == 0)
- return 0;
-#endif
+ return;
+# endif
-#if HAVE_GETTIMEOFDAY
+# if HAVE_GETTIMEOFDAY
{
struct timeval tv;
- if (gettimeofday (&tv, 0) == 0)
- {
- ts->tv_sec = tv.tv_sec;
- ts->tv_nsec = tv.tv_usec * 1000;
- return 0;
- }
+ gettimeofday (&tv, NULL);
+ ts->tv_sec = tv.tv_sec;
+ ts->tv_nsec = tv.tv_usec * 1000;
}
-#endif
+# else
+ ts->tv_sec = time (NULL);
+ ts->tv_nsec = 0;
+# endif
- {
- time_t t = time (0);
- if (t != (time_t) -1)
- {
- ts->tv_sec = t;
- ts->tv_nsec = 0;
- return 0;
- }
- }
-
- return -1;
+#endif
}
--- /home/cvs/shishi/gl/mktime.c 2004/12/17 13:44:05 1.7
+++ /home/cvs/shishi/gl/mktime.c 2005/03/14 14:32:14 1.8
@@ -1,5 +1,6 @@
/* Convert a `struct tm' to a time_t value.
- Copyright (C) 1993-1999, 2002, 2003, 2004 Free Software Foundation, Inc.
+ Copyright (C) 1993-1999, 2002, 2003, 2004, 2005 Free Software Foundation,
+ Inc.
This file is part of the GNU C Library.
Contributed by Paul Eggert (address@hidden).
@@ -60,10 +61,25 @@
? (a) >> (b) \
: (a) / (1 << (b)) - ((a) % (1 << (b)) < 0))
-/* The extra casts work around common compiler bugs. */
+/* The extra casts in the following macros work around compiler bugs,
+ e.g., in Cray C 5.0.3.0. */
+
+/* True if the arithmetic type T is an integer type. bool counts as
+ an integer. */
+#define TYPE_IS_INTEGER(t) ((t) 1.5 == 1)
+
+/* True if negative values of the integer type T use twos complement
+ representation. */
+#define TYPE_TWOS_COMPLEMENT(t) ((t) - (t) 1 == (t) ((t) ~ (t) 1 + (t) 1))
+
+/* True if the arithmetic type T is signed. */
#define TYPE_SIGNED(t) (! ((t) 0 < (t) -1))
-/* The outer cast is needed to work around a bug in Cray C 5.0.3.0.
- It is necessary at least when t == time_t. */
+
+/* The maximum and minimum values for the integer type T. These
+ macros have undefined behavior if T is signed and has padding bits
+ (i.e., bits that do not contribute to the value), or if T uses
+ signed-magnitude representation. If this is a problem for you,
+ please let us know how to fix it for your host. */
#define TYPE_MINIMUM(t) ((t) (TYPE_SIGNED (t) \
? ~ (t) 0 << (sizeof (t) * CHAR_BIT - 1) : (t) 0))
#define TYPE_MAXIMUM(t) ((t) (~ (t) 0 - TYPE_MINIMUM (t)))
@@ -79,8 +95,8 @@
/* Verify a requirement at compile-time (unlike assert, which is runtime). */
#define verify(name, assertion) struct name { char a[(assertion) ? 1 : -1]; }
-verify (time_t_is_integer, (time_t) 0.5 == 0);
-verify (twos_complement_arithmetic, -1 == ~1 + 1);
+verify (time_t_is_integer, TYPE_IS_INTEGER (time_t));
+verify (twos_complement_arithmetic, TYPE_TWOS_COMPLEMENT (int));
/* The code also assumes that signed integer overflow silently wraps
around, but this assumption can't be stated without causing a
diagnostic on some hosts. */
